F1 rule change for Honda's upgrades hits last-minute snag

F1 rule change for Honda's upgrades hits last-minute snag

Uncertainty grows over changes that could help a struggling engine maker improve performance. A planned vote on adjusting Formula 1 rules to give Honda extra upgrade opportunities was unexpectedly halted just before it was due. The proposal involved altering limits in the Additional Development and Upgrade Opportunities system, which governs how teams gain extra resources and development freedom.
